Deciphering the Planet Fitness Locker System

At most Planet Fitness locations, you’ll find two main types of locker options: daily use lockers and, in some cases, lockers available for rent. The Planet Fitness locker system is designed with simplicity and member convenience in mind.

Daily Use Lockers

These are the most common lockers available at Planet Fitness. They are designed for members to use during their workout session and are emptied at the end of each day.

  • How to Use:

    1. Locate an Available Locker: Find an empty locker in the designated locker room area.
    2. Bring Your Own Lock: You will need to bring your own padlock. Planet Fitness generally does not provide locks for daily use lockers.
    3. Secure Your Belongings: Place your items inside the locker and attach your padlock to the locker hasp. Ensure it’s firmly secured.
    4. Remember Your Locker Number: Make a note of the locker number you are using.
    5. Retrieve Your Items: When you’re finished with your workout, unlock your locker, remove your belongings, and take your lock with you.
  • Planet Fitness Locker Policy for Daily Use: The Planet Fitness locker policy clearly states that all items left in daily use lockers at the end of the day will be considered abandoned. These items are typically collected by staff and may be donated or disposed of. It’s crucial to remove all your belongings and your lock before leaving the facility.

Planet Fitness Locker Rental

Some Planet Fitness clubs offer the option to rent a locker on a longer-term basis, usually monthly. This is a great option if you prefer to leave some workout essentials at the gym.

  • How to Secure a Rental:

    1. Inquire at the Front Desk: Locker rental availability and pricing can vary by location. Speak to a staff member at the front desk to see if lockers are available for rent at your specific club.
    2. Fill Out Necessary Paperwork: You may need to sign a rental agreement and provide payment information.
    3. Receive Your Locker Key or Code: Once rented, you will be assigned a specific locker and given a key or a combination code to access it.
    4. Enjoy Long-Term Storage: You can then use this locker throughout your rental period, leaving items like gym shoes, towels, or extra workout gear.
  • Planet Fitness Locker Rental Costs: The cost of locker rental typically varies. It’s best to check with your local club for current pricing. These rentals usually come with a monthly fee.

The Planet Fitness Locker Policy in Detail

Understanding the official Planet Fitness locker policy is essential for all members to avoid any misunderstandings or the loss of personal items.

Key Aspects of the Policy:

  • Daily Use: Lockers marked for daily use are intended for temporary storage only during your visit.
  • End-of-Day Cleanup: All items left in daily use lockers at closing time are considered abandoned property. Planet Fitness staff will typically collect these items.
  • Abandoned Property: Abandoned items are usually held for a limited period (e.g., 30 days) before being donated to charity or disposed of. Check with your local club for their specific policy on abandoned items.
  • No Overnight Storage: Unless you have a specific locker rental agreement, overnight storage is prohibited.
  • Gym Not Liable: As mentioned, Planet Fitness generally disclaims responsibility for any loss or theft of personal belongings from lockers.
  • Locker Rental Terms: If you rent a locker, you agree to specific terms and conditions, including rental fees and proper usage.
  • Lock Removal: For daily use lockers, members are responsible for removing their lock along with their belongings. Any locks left on daily lockers overnight may be cut off by staff.
